Title: The Walled City
Name: Stefan Morrell
Country: New Zealand
Software: 3ds max, finalRender, Photoshop

Another futurescape,with this image I'm trying to push myself into using more color,

Inspired by the layered & cluttered look of Kowloon walled city(which has now been torn down & made into a park)..
along with the obvious Blade Runner/Fifth Element etc

the glow on the boat/ship..I tried it without the glow & found the ship faded into the background too much,I felt it needed something bright to make it a focal point.

ACanteral...it took around 4 days to put together,a few of the models are things I've made in the past,& mixing up the styles helped in creating the layered look.
rendertime was a couple hours at 4k res,various other elements were rendered seperately & comped in,if I'd rendered it all in one hit it would be millions of polys

Dangeruss...there are a few people in the scene if you look hard enough,several office workers looking out the large window,another one greeting a robot before entering the building.but they are all very small details & not meant to be any kind of focal point.
